IPP Software Navigation Tools IPP Links Communication Pan-STARRS Links

Changeset 13644


Ignore:
Timestamp:
Jun 5, 2007, 9:55:14 AM (19 years ago)
Author:
Paul Price
Message:

Updating test build system for psModules to match that for psLib.

Location:
trunk/psModules
Files:
9 edited

Legend:

Unmodified
Added
Removed
  • trunk/psModules/configure.ac

    r13397 r13644  
    2828
    2929AC_PREFIX_DEFAULT([`pwd`])
     30
     31dnl build tests at the same time as the source code
     32AC_ARG_ENABLE(tests,
     33  [AS_HELP_STRING(--enable-tests,build tests at same time as source)],
     34  [AC_MSG_RESULT(test building enabled)
     35   tests=true],
     36   [tests=false])
     37AM_CONDITIONAL(BUILD_TESTS, test x$tests = xtrue)
    3038
    3139dnl ------------------- PERL options ---------------------
  • trunk/psModules/test/astrom/Makefile.am

    r10824 r13644  
    1111        $(PSMODULES_LIBS)
    1212
    13 check_PROGRAMS = \
     13TEST_PROGS = \
    1414        tap_pmAstrometryWCS \
    1515        tap_pmAstrometryWCS_DVO \
     
    1818        tap_pmAstrometryWCS_DVO4
    1919
     20if BUILD_TESTS
     21bin_PROGRAMS = $(TEST_PROGS)
     22TESTS = $(TEST_PROGS)
     23else
     24check_PROGRAMS = $(TEST_PROGS)
     25endif
     26
     27C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
     28
    2029test: check
    21 
    22 tests: $(check_PROGRAMS)
    2330        $(top_srcdir)/test/test.pl
    24 
  • trunk/psModules/test/camera/Makefile.am

    r9722 r13644  
    1 AM_LDFLAGS = -L$(top_builddir)/src -lpsmodules $(PSMODULES_LIBS)
    2 AM_CFLAGS  = @AM_CFLAGS@ $(PSMODULES_CFLAGS) $(SRCINC)
    3 AM_CPPFLAGS = $(SRCINC) $(PSLIB_CFLAGS)
     1AM_CPPFLAGS = \
     2        $(SRCINC) \
     3        -I$(top_srcdir)/test/tap/src \
     4        -I$(top_srcdir)/test/pstap/src \
     5        $(PSMODULES_CFLAGS)
    46
    5 check_PROGRAMS =
     7AM_LDFLAGS = \
     8        $(top_builddir)/src/libpsmodules.la  \
     9        $(top_builddir)/test/tap/src/libtap.la \
     10        $(top_builddir)/test/pstap/src/libpstap.la \
     11        $(PSMODULES_LIBS)
     12
     13TEST_PROGS =
     14
     15if BUILD_TESTS
     16bin_PROGRAMS = $(TEST_PROGS)
     17TESTS = $(TEST_PROGS)
     18else
     19check_PROGRAMS = $(TEST_PROGS)
     20endif
     21
     22C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
    623
    724test: check
     25        $(top_srcdir)/test/test.pl
  • trunk/psModules/test/concepts/Makefile.am

    r9722 r13644  
    1 AM_LDFLAGS = -L$(top_builddir)/src -lpsmodules $(PSMODULES_LIBS)
    2 AM_CFLAGS  = @AM_CFLAGS@ $(PSMODULES_CFLAGS) $(SRCINC)
    3 AM_CPPFLAGS = $(SRCINC) $(PSLIB_CFLAGS)
     1AM_CPPFLAGS = \
     2        $(SRCINC) \
     3        -I$(top_srcdir)/test/tap/src \
     4        -I$(top_srcdir)/test/pstap/src \
     5        $(PSMODULES_CFLAGS)
    46
    5 check_PROGRAMS =
     7AM_LDFLAGS = \
     8        $(top_builddir)/src/libpsmodules.la  \
     9        $(top_builddir)/test/tap/src/libtap.la \
     10        $(top_builddir)/test/pstap/src/libpstap.la \
     11        $(PSMODULES_LIBS)
     12
     13TEST_PROGS =
     14
     15if BUILD_TESTS
     16bin_PROGRAMS = $(TEST_PROGS)
     17TESTS = $(TEST_PROGS)
     18else
     19check_PROGRAMS = $(TEST_PROGS)
     20endif
     21
     22C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
    623
    724test: check
     25        $(top_srcdir)/test/test.pl
  • trunk/psModules/test/config/Makefile.am

    r13625 r13644  
    1 
    21AM_CPPFLAGS = \
    32        $(SRCINC) \
     
    1211        $(PSMODULES_LIBS)
    1312
    14 AM_CFLAGS  = @AM_CFLAGS@ $(PSMODULES_CFLAGS) $(SRCINC)
    15 
    16 check_PROGRAMS =
     13TEST_PROGS = \
     14        tst_pmConfig
    1715
    1816check_DATA = \
     
    2422EXTRA_DIST = data
    2523
    26 CLEANFILES = $(check_DATA) *~
     24if BUILD_TESTS
     25bin_PROGRAMS = $(TEST_PROGS)
     26TESTS = $(TEST_PROGS)
     27else
     28check_PROGRAMS = $(TEST_PROGS)
     29endif
     30
     31C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
    2732
    2833test: check
     34        $(top_srcdir)/test/test.pl
  • trunk/psModules/test/detrend/Makefile.am

    r9877 r13644  
    1 
    21AM_CPPFLAGS = \
    32        $(SRCINC) \
     
    1211        $(PSMODULES_LIBS)
    1312
    14 check_PROGRAMS = tap_pmShutterCorrection
     13TEST_PROGS = \
     14        tap_pmShutterCorrection
    1515
    16 CLEANFILES = temp/* core core.* *~
     16if BUILD_TESTS
     17bin_PROGRAMS = $(TEST_PROGS)
     18TESTS = $(TEST_PROGS)
     19else
     20check_PROGRAMS = $(TEST_PROGS)
     21endif
     22
     23C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
    1724
    1825test: check
     26        $(top_srcdir)/test/test.pl
  • trunk/psModules/test/extras/Makefile.am

    r10610 r13644  
    1 
    21AM_CPPFLAGS = \
    32        $(SRCINC) \
     
    1211        $(PSMODULES_LIBS)
    1312
    14 # XXX is this desired?
    15 # AM_CFLAGS  = @AM_CFLAGS@ $(PSMODULES_CFLAGS) $(SRCINC)
     13TEST_PROGS =
    1614
    17 check_PROGRAMS =
     15if BUILD_TESTS
     16bin_PROGRAMS = $(TEST_PROGS)
     17TESTS = $(TEST_PROGS)
     18else
     19check_PROGRAMS = $(TEST_PROGS)
     20endif
     21
     22C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
    1823
    1924test: check
     25        $(top_srcdir)/test/test.pl
  • trunk/psModules/test/imcombine/Makefile.am

    r11118 r13644  
    1111        $(PSMODULES_LIBS)
    1212
    13 TESTS = \
     13TEST_PROGS = \
    1414        tap_pmImageCombine
    1515
    16 check_PROGRAMS = $(TESTS)
     16if BUILD_TESTS
     17bin_PROGRAMS = $(TEST_PROGS)
     18TESTS = $(TEST_PROGS)
     19else
     20check_PROGRAMS = $(TEST_PROGS)
     21endif
    1722
    18 CLEANFILES = $(TESTS) temp/* *~
     23C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
    1924
    2025test: check
     26        $(top_srcdir)/test/test.pl
  • trunk/psModules/test/objects/Makefile.am

    r10194 r13644  
    1 
    21AM_CPPFLAGS = \
    32        $(SRCINC) \
     
    1211        $(PSMODULES_LIBS)
    1312
    14 # XXX is this desired?
    15 # AM_CFLAGS  = @AM_CFLAGS@ $(PSMODULES_CFLAGS) $(SRCINC)
    16 
    17 check_PROGRAMS = \
     13TEST_PROGS = \
    1814        tap_pmSourcePhotometry \
    1915        tap_pmGrowthCurve \
     
    2117        tap_pmSourceFitModel_Delta
    2218
     19if BUILD_TESTS
     20bin_PROGRAMS = $(TEST_PROGS)
     21TESTS = $(TEST_PROGS)
     22else
     23check_PROGRAMS = $(TEST_PROGS)
     24endif
     25
     26CLEANFILES = $(check_DATA) temp/* core core.* *~ *.bb *.bbg *.da gmon.out
     27
    2328test: check
     29        $(top_srcdir)/test/test.pl
Note: See TracChangeset for help on using the changeset viewer.